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about preschools in Readville, MA:

What is the average cost of preschool in Readville, MA, and are there any financial assistance programs available?

The average cost for a full-time preschool program in Readville typically ranges from $12,000 to $18,000 annually. For financial assistance, you can apply for a voucher through the Massachusetts Department of Early Education and Care (EEC) or inquire directly with preschools about sliding scale tuition. Additionally, some local centers may offer sibling discounts or accept state subsidies.

How can I verify the quality and licensing of a preschool in Readville?

All licensed preschools in Massachusetts are regulated by the Department of Early Education and Care (EEC). You can search for a specific program's licensing status, compliance history, and any reported violations on the EEC's online licensor portal. It's also highly recommended to visit the preschool in person, observe the classrooms, and ask about staff qualifications and curriculum.

What are the typical enrollment timelines and waitlist situations for Readville preschools?

Many preschools in Readville and the greater Boston area have application deadlines in January or February for the following September start, with some offering rolling admission if space allows. Due to high demand, popular programs often have waitlists, so it's advisable to begin your search and schedule tours at least a year in advance. Inquire directly about each school's specific timeline and deposit requirements.

What transportation options are available for preschools in Readville, given its proximity to commuter rail and bus lines?

Most preschools in the area do not provide dedicated transportation; parents are typically responsible for drop-off and pick-up. However, Readville's access to the Commuter Rail (Franklin/Foxboro Line) and MBTA bus routes (like the 32) can make it easier for caregivers using public transit to reach programs in nearby towns. Always confirm a school's specific location relative to transit stops when planning your commute.
